Ralph Baum (4 October 1908 – 1987) was a French film producer and production manager particularly associated with Max Ophüls whose career spanned from 1930 to 1985 across more than 50 films. He also directed four films. Source: Article "Ralph Baum" from Wikipedia in English, licensed under CC-BY-SA.
